我确实对数据库规范化有一些想法,但有时我认为,在某些情况下,有一个比 ONE DATA OBJECT = ONE TABLE 模式更优雅的解决方案(我相信)。
例如:文章和静态页面的存储。数据非常相似,我们可以使用一个简单的标识符列将它们放在一个表中,并且由于不同,我们实际存储的数据对于每种数据类型都会有一些空白的未使用列:
id | title(both) | author(article only) | content(both) | datetime(article only) | type(identificator - article/page)
这种方法是否仍然正确,或者无论相似之处如何,每个数据都应该有表格?